Product’s Cooling Capacity Details
When considering the Midea Duo 12,000 BTU (10,000 BTU SACC) High Efficiency Inverter Portable Air Conditioner’s cooling capacity, you’ll find it excels in efficiently cooling spaces up to 450 square feet.
Its innovative inverter technology enhances cooling efficiency, guaranteeing consistent temperature regulation. You’ll appreciate the room suitability this unit offers, especially in moderately-sized living rooms or bedrooms.
Compared to traditional models, the Duo’s advanced hose-in-hose design minimizes hot air infiltration, boosting performance. Its 26-foot airflow projection further guarantees thorough coverage, making it a superior choice for maintaining comfort in your desired space without compromising on cooling effectiveness.
Efficient Energy-Saving Performance
Building on the Midea Duo’s impressive cooling capacity, its energy-saving performance stands out through its advanced inverter technology.
This variable-speed technology optimizes energy efficiency by adjusting compressor speed to match cooling demands, reducing power usage by over 40% compared to traditional units.
You’ll appreciate how the Duo maintains a consistent temperature without frequent cycling, minimizing energy waste.
Its 1,200-watt power input aligns with eco-friendly standards, offering substantial savings on your electricity bills.
Unlike conventional models, the Duo excels in dynamic energy regulation, making it a superior choice for those prioritizing sustainable cooling solutions in their homes.

How Do I Clean and Maintain the Air Filter?
To clean the air filter, remove it from the unit. Use a vacuum for dust removal, then rinse with warm water. Make certain it’s completely dry before reinserting. Regular maintenance maximizes efficiency and prolongs the unit’s lifespan.
